- 博客(48)
- 资源 (7)
- 收藏
- 关注
原创 工具箱-docker学习笔记(一) 基本操作
如果没有虚拟机的小伙伴(或者想用和我一样搭建虚拟机的小伙伴) 可以参照下面的方式先下载安装好软件,课程中会用到 在同级目录中我放了一个virtualbox.box,课程中也会用到一、下载安装vagrant 01 访问Vagrant官网 https://www.vagrantup.com/02 点击DownloadWindows,MacOS,Linux等03 选择对应的版本...
2020-05-06 22:19:51 799
原创 SpringBoot RabbitMq 异常 踩坑: AmqpException: No method found for class
先看看错误:2019-01-15 14:40:21.476 [SimpleAsyncTaskExecutor-47] WARN org.springframework.amqp.rabbit.listener.ConditionalRejectingErrorHandler - Execution of Rabbit message listener failed.org.springf...
2019-01-15 17:30:24 12710
原创 jstree 创建实例注意事项
1. 注意,如果不清空实例,jstree不会重新生成,许多事件会受到影响$('#jstree1').data('jstree', false).empty();
2017-10-30 16:50:26 476
原创 JPA 级联标签的解释 @Cascade
在这篇文章中,我只简单的介绍级联操作各参数的含义。至于,如何使用和效果,将会与各种关系结合使用,请参照我的其他帮助手册。 CascadeType.PRESIST 级联持久化(保存)操作(持久保存拥有方实体时,也会持久保存该实体的所有相关数据。)===============================================================
2017-07-20 14:28:39 502
原创 Hibernate级联操作 注解
EJB3 支持的操作类型[java] /** * Cascade types (can override default EJB3 cascades */ public enum CascadeType { ALL, PERSIST, MERGE, REMOVE, REFRESH, D
2017-07-20 11:36:59 504
转载 Myeclipse搭建Maven开发环境
我用的是myeclipse6.5和Maven3.0.3,与其他版本的有点出入,其实所谓的出入基本算大同小异。 下载Maven3.0.3到本地,解压后配置Maven环境变量,在用户变量中新建变量名:maven_home,变量值:C:\Program Files\apache-maven-3.0.3(根据自己机器上解压后的maven所在的位置而定);而后在path变量的变量值最后面加上"%m
2017-03-01 10:07:00 256
原创 Css Html 鼠标移上标签展示图表
cursor其他取值 auto 标准光标 default 标准箭头 pointer, hand 手形光标 wait 等待光标 text I形光标 vertical-text 水平I形光标 no-drop 不可拖动光标 not-allowed 无效光标 help 帮助光标 all-scroll 三角方
2017-02-28 10:10:52 849
转载 java实现字符串转换成可执行代码
使用commons的jexl可实现将字符串变成可执行代码的功能,我写了一个类来封装这个功能:import java.util.Map; import org.apache.commons.jexl2.Expression; import org.apache.commons.jexl2.JexlContext; import org.apache.commons.je
2017-02-14 09:44:42 1501
转载 MongoDB使用小结
1、count统计结果错误这是由于分布式集群正在迁移数据,它导致count结果值错误,需要使用aggregate pipeline来得到正确统计结果,例如:db.collection.aggregate([{$group: {_id: null, count: {$sum: 1}}}])引用:“On a sharded cluster, count can result i
2017-01-25 13:04:52 385
原创 js json格式化展示
js json格式化展示var formatJson = function(json, options) { var reg = null, formatted = ”, pad = 0, PADDING = ’ ‘; // one can also use ‘\t’ or a different number of spaces
2017-01-10 15:44:30 3328
原创 欢迎使用CSDN-markdown编辑器
easyui datagrid 自动换行定义表单 nowrap=”false”可以使得列中的内容超出所定义的列宽是就会自动换行 pagination : true, // 当true时在DataGrid底部显示一个分页工具栏。默认falserownumbers : true, // 当true时显示行号。默认false border : true,// 表格是否出现边框,默认是出现的。fal
2017-01-03 10:27:12 251
原创 Velocity遍历List和Map
List: #foreach($obj in $list) $obj.name - $obj.age #end Map: #foreach($map in $mapArr.entrySet()) $map.key- $map.value #end
2016-12-23 10:37:58 931
转载 Spring 反射注入+全注解注入
Spring IoC容器会先把所有的Bean都进行实例化,不管是要用到的火鼠用不到的,如果你想暂时不进行Bean的实例化,要用到属性lazy-init="true".Spring的三种注入方式:① 构造注入:通过构造器(constructor)注入② 设值注入:通过Setter方法注入③ 反射注入:通过注解(annotation)的方式注入Spring
2016-12-15 14:49:47 2135 1
转载 Spring事务处理探究
开发环境: OS:windows XP Web Server: jakarta-tomcat-5.0.28 DataBase Server: MS SQL Server 2000 (打了SP3补丁) IDE: MyEclipse 6.0.1 测试案例系统结构: web层Service 层DA
2016-12-15 14:49:13 260
转载 CentOS 6.5安装配置Nginx
Ubuntu下安装nginx,直接apt-get install nginx就行了,很方便。但是今天装了CentOS6.5,直接yum install nginx不行,要先处理下源,下面是安装完整流程,也十分简单:1、CentOS 6,先执行:rpm -ivh http://nginx.org/packages/centos/6/noarch/RPMS/nginx-releas
2016-12-15 14:46:45 231
转载 entOS查看CPU、内存、网络流量和磁盘 I/O
安装 yum install -y sysstatsar -d 1 1rrqm/s: 每秒进行 merge 的读操作数目。即 delta(rmerge)/swrqm/s: 每秒进行 merge 的写操作数目。即 delta(wmerge)/sr/s: 每秒完成的读 I/O 设备次数。即 delta(rio)/sw/s: 每秒完成的写 I/O 设备次数。即 delta(w
2016-12-15 14:45:45 540
转载 Java7语法新特性
Java7语法新特性: 1. switch中增加对String类型的支持。 public String generate(String name, String gender) { String title = ""; switch (gender) { case "男": title = name
2016-12-15 14:44:20 231
转载 关于spring session redis共享session的跨子域的处理
安装完redis, spring端只要下面这两个bean配置上就可以用了12345678910111213<?xml version="1.0" encoding="UTF-8"?><beans xmlns="http://www.
2016-12-15 14:34:58 1050
转载 Mysql 不同版本 说明
Mysql 的官网下载地址: http://dev.mysql.com/downloads/ 在这个下载界面会有几个版本的选择。 1. MySQL Community Server 社区版本,免费,但是Mysql不提供官方技术支持。 MySQLCommunity Server is a freely dow
2016-12-15 14:32:41 230
转载 redis + Tomcat 8 的session共享解决
如果英文不错的看,建议直接看官网吧,官网写的挺清楚。下面的内容是转载的一篇文章,自己补充了一些,供大家参考,也欢迎大家一起讨论官方截止到2015-10-12前是不支持Tomcat8的,详情见官网:https://github.com/jcoleman/tomcat-redis-session-manager锐洋智能修改的支持Tomcat8的 reyo.redis.session.m
2016-12-15 14:23:52 1907
转载 java 遍历arrayList的四种方法
package com.test;import java.util.ArrayList;import java.util.Iterator;import java.util.List;public class ArrayListDemo { public static void main(String args[]){ List list = n
2016-12-15 14:23:09 233
转载 关于 tomcat 集群中 session 共享的三种方法
前两种均需要使用 memcached 或 redis 存储 session ,最后一种使用 terracotta 服务器共享。 建议使用 redis ,不仅仅因为它可以将缓存的内容持久化,还因为它支持的单个对象比较大,而且数据类型丰富, 不只是缓存 session ,还可以做其他用途,一举几得啊。test url: http://sms.reyo.cn/session.jsp
2016-12-15 14:21:07 350
原创 java操作mongodb进行查询,常用筛选条件
条件列表:BasicDBList condList = new BasicDBList(); 临时条件对象:BasicDBObject cond = null;DBCollection coll = db.getCollection("A");1、$where在某种应用场合,若要集合A查询文档且要满足文档中某些属性运算结果,可以编写一脚本函数用where进行设置,比如:某集合中存放
2016-12-14 17:47:31 5250
原创 文章标题
easyUi combobox 设置其下拉框的高度$(‘#cc’).combobox({ url:’combobox_data.json’, valueField:’id’, textField:’text’, listHeight: 你的高度 }); 实验了下,在JS里写没什
2016-12-07 17:05:55 178
转载 欢迎使用CSDN-markdown编辑器
Linux常用文件操作命令1 改变目录 要进入相应的目录我们可以使用Linux下的改变目录命令cd (ChangeDirectory)。 下面我要进入到/tmp目录下,如下操作:[root@bestlinux ~]# cd /tmp/你会看到有地方变了,是的,就是在PS1那个位置有所改变,由原来的“~”变为了“tmp”。那么 ~ 又是什么意思呢?其实 ~表示的就是家目录的意思,既然表示的是家
2016-12-07 14:53:28 172
转载 mongodb 数据库操作--备份 还原 导出 导入
mongodb数据备份和还原主要分为二种,一种是针对于库的mongodump和mongorestore,一种是针对库中表的mongoexport和mongoimport。一,mongodump备份数据库1,常用命令格?1mongodump -h IP --port 端口 -u 用户名 -p 密码 -d 数据库
2016-12-06 10:12:56 224
原创 mysql下登陆并执行脚本
mysql下如何执行sql脚本首要步骤(一般可省略):开启mysql服务(默认是开机时就自动运行了):控制面板-->管理工具-->服务,在里面找到名称为mysql的项,双击就可看它的服务状态是启动还是停止,把它设为启动连接mysql:在命令行下输入 mysql -h localhost -u root -p回车,然后输入密码即可;或直接运行mysql自带的连接工具,然后输入
2016-11-29 16:51:57 1940
原创 MySQL INTO OUTFILE导出导入数据|mysqldump
--将刚刚导出的文件log1.txt导入到表log1相同结构的LOG2中点击(此处)折叠或打开LOAD DATA INFILE 'C:\\log1.txt' INTO TABLE
2016-11-29 16:07:27 1019
原创 Mariadb(mysql)基本操作
1.:安装与初始化1)安装 yum install -y mariadb/* 2)初始化systemctl restart mariadbsystemctl enable mariadbmysql_secure_installation查看数据库版本:select 'version' ;除设置密码外,一直摁"y"。
2016-11-29 15:57:07 741
原创 Java 遍历Map时 删除元素
public class HashMapTest { private static Map map=new HashMap(); /** 1.HashMap 类映射不保证顺序;某些映射可明确保证其顺序: TreeMap 类 * 2.在遍历Map过程中,不能用map.put(key,newVal),map.remove(key)来修改和删除元
2016-11-21 15:23:34 293
转载 MongoDB MapReduce学习笔记
MapReduce应该算是MongoDB操作中比较复杂的了,自己开始理解的时候还是动了动脑子的,所以记录在此!命令语法:详细看db.runCommand( { mapreduce : 字符串,集合名, map : 函数,见下文 reduce : 函数,见下文 [, query : 文档,发往
2016-11-17 12:54:59 207
转载 javascript定时器小结
javascript有两种定显示器, setTimeout和setInterval,下面简要介绍两个函数然后附上简单的例子。setTimeout(function, time) , 当定位到time间隔则执行function函数,执行一次就不再执行clearTimeout(t), 结束setTimeout定时器setInterval(function, time), 每隔time
2016-11-14 14:32:48 229
原创 javascript实现IE6-IE9+,firefox,chrome客户端图片预览
javascript实现IE,firefox客户端图片预览 //使用IE条件注释来判断是否IE6,通过判断userAgent不一定准确 if (document.all) document.write('window.ie6= true'); // var ie6 = /msie 6/i.test(navigator.userAgent);//不推荐,有些系统的i
2016-11-09 15:40:37 1106
转载 使用JavaScript创建模块化的双人对战象棋程序
1. 关于这篇文章2004年,我花两天时间,用JavaScript和VML创建了一个单机双人象棋,并且作了简短的分析。在那个时代,没有AngularJS,没有BackBone,没有所有这些前端MV*框架。甚至没有jQuery,没有prototype,没有mootools,因此没有什么可借鉴的模块划分方式。我只好用很原始的办法,做了一种伪继承,实际是组合,来实现棋子和棋局之间的关系。
2016-10-08 10:32:00 1620 1
转载 从零开始编写JavaScript框架
有一定Web前端开发经验的人,很多都会有这么个想法:那些写框架的人好厉害,什么时候我才能写一个自己的框架呢?有时候看看别人的框架代码,又觉得很复杂,不知道从何看起,只有很少的人突破了这个界限,领悟到了更深层的东西。 对于这种情况,我觉得有必要改变一下。为此,打算自己写几个系列的文章来让很多人能从中领会一些前端框架的知识,带领他们走进框架开发的殿堂。 为了说明框架的一些基本原理,我写
2016-10-08 10:22:51 552
转载 从零开始编写自己的JavaScript框架(二)
2. 数据绑定2.1 数据绑定的原理数据绑定是一种很便捷的特性,一些RIA框架带有双向绑定功能,比如Flex和Silverlight,当某个数据发生变更时,所绑定的界面元素也发生变更,当界面元素的值发生变化时,数据也跟着变化,这种功能在处理表单数据的填充和收集时,是非常有用的。在HTML中,原生是没有这样的功能的,但有些框架做到了,它们是怎么做到的呢?我们来做个简单的试试,
2016-10-08 10:19:01 1501
转载 从零开始写JavaScript框架(一)
1. 模块的定义和加载1.1 模块的定义一个框架想要能支撑较大的应用,首先要考虑怎么做模块化。有了内核和模块加载系统,外围的模块就可以一个一个增加。不同的JavaScript框架,实现模块化方式各有不同,我们来选择一种比较优雅的方式作个讲解。先问个问题:我们做模块系统的目的是什么?如果觉得这个问题难以回答,可以从反面来考虑:假如不做模块系统,有什么样的坏处?我们经历
2016-10-08 10:15:43 2601 2
转载 欢迎使用CSDN-markdown编辑器
如果对算法有所了解,读这篇文章时你可能会问“作者知道算法为何物吗?”,或是“Facebook的‘信息流’(News Feed)算是一种算法吗?”,如果“信息流”是算法,那就可以把所有事物都归结为一种算法。 才疏学浅,结合那篇帖子,接下来我试着解释一下算法是什么,又是哪些算法正在主导我们的世界。 什么是算法? 简而言之,任何定义明确的计算步骤都可称为算法,接受一个或一组值为输入,输出一个或一组值
2016-01-14 09:58:28 260
转载 easyui 重复提交url
就我所知,原因有二:一:重复初始化1、传统方式查看文本打印 1 $(function () { 2 var url = "../Source/Query/jhDataQry.ashx?action=query"; 3 $(dg).datagrid({ 4
2015-09-25 16:02:29 957
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人